It's designed to enable dental implant surgeons to diagnose and provide an immediate functional and aesthetic tooth replacement with predictability.
During University College London (UCL)'s Implant Dentistry - All-On-4 and Immediate Loading course you'll:
- become familiar with the history and principles of the All-on-4 technique
- understand the principles of treatment planning an All-on-4 case
- see and become familiar with the planning stages for an All-on-4 procedure
- see the surgical placement and immediate loading of a single jaw
- understand the use of CBCT (cone beam computed tomography) in diagnosis and planning
- see the use of guided surgery to aid implant placement
- see the surgical and restorative stages for the All-on-4 procedure
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Patient assessment, basic implant science
- Implant planning for immediate placement and loading
- Implant treatment sequence
- Hands-on implant placement on specially designed models and restoration
- Hands-on implant provisional for single unit
- Theory of immediate loading for single to full arch including the All-on-4 technique
- Live surgery demonstrating the All-on-4 technique

The course is aimed at experienced implant surgeons who'd like to develop an overview of this rapidly changing field. It serves as an excellent introduction to further training in implant treatment.You'll need to hold an approved dental qualification and be an experienced implant surgeon.
